We’ve been a part of The Wonderful Company family since 1979, with a nationwide network of florists we’ve become the world’s largest flower delivery service. With more than 10,000 member florists in North America, we lead the industry by working directly with our florists to hand-arrange and hand deliver every bouquet! We’re a sustainable network of locally owned florists. Teleflora provides innovative marketing, education and technology to make sure our member florists get the resources they need to thrive, creating beautiful bouquets with keepsake vases delivered to your door.Teleflora, the world’s largest floral wire service and a leader in floral technology and fulfillment, is seeking an analytically driven and strategically minded **Manager, Partnership Growth & Strategy** to help accelerate performance across our most important partnership channels.This role is ideal for someone who thrives at the intersection of **data analysis, partner marketing strategy, and revenue growth**.
